Core Innovations and Technical Features
The R2023a release introduces several pivotal updates that streamline the development-to-deployment pipeline:
Live Editor Enhancements: Users can now interactively find and remove periodic or polynomial trends from data directly within live scripts, making exploratory data analysis more intuitive.
Expanded Data Interoperability: The update includes enhanced support for Python, allowing for seamless conversions between Python and NumPy data types. This is critical for teams integrating MATLAB’s robust toolboxes with open-source machine learning frameworks.
Pivot Table Functionality: The introduction of the pivot function allows users to summarize tabular data efficiently, bringing spreadsheet-like ease of use to programmatic environments.

MATLAB R2023a (v9.14) is a significant update that prioritizes workflow efficiency through better data handling, enhanced Python integration, and a major overhaul of debugging tools in Simulink. Core MATLAB Enhancements
Pivot Tables: The new pivot function allows you to summarize and analyze tabular data directly, similar to Excel, without needing complex loops or data extraction.
Table Calculations: You can now perform calculations directly on table and timetable data types, which streamlines data processing tasks. Live Editor Updates:
Interactive Tasks: New tasks allow for interactive data importing and the removal of trends (periodic or polynomial) from datasets.
Plain Text Format: Live scripts can now be saved as plain text (.m) files, making them significantly easier to manage with source control like GitHub.
Python Integration: Improved support for Python and NumPy data type conversions, including the ability to use Python objects as keys in MATLAB dictionaries. Simulink & Toolbox Highlights
Block-by-Block Stepping: A major update to the Simulink Editor replaces the old standalone debugger, allowing you to step through simulations one block at a time directly on the canvas. mathworks matlab r2023a v91402206163 filecr high quality
Aerospace Blockset: Now supports high-fidelity simulation of rotorcraft and multirotor dynamics, with 3D visualization options using Unreal Engine or Cesium ion.
Wireless & Communication: The Communications Toolbox now includes ray tracing for indoor and outdoor environments, and the Phased Array System Toolbox adds support for massive MIMO beamforming.

MathWorks MATLAB R2023a (version 9.14.0.2206163) is a major release of the widely-used programming and numeric computing platform. It introduces over 3,600 new features and significant updates across its toolbox ecosystem, focusing on improving developer workflows, data analysis, and integration with other languages like Python. Key Features and Updates in R2023a
The R2023a release brings several core enhancements to the MATLAB environment:
Live Editor Enhancements: New Live Editor Tasks allow you to interactively import data and remove periodic or polynomial trends directly within live scripts.
Data Handling: A new pivot function enables the creation of pivot tables to summarize tabular data. Additionally, you can now perform calculations directly within table and timetable data types without extracting the data first.
Python Integration: Improved support for converting Python and NumPy data types and the ability to use Python objects as keys in MATLAB dictionaries.
Code Quality: The Code Analyzer App and fix function help you identify and programmatically resolve code issues.
Simulink: The old Simulink Debugger has been replaced with a new capability to step block-by-block through simulations for easier troubleshooting. System Requirements

The Pursuit of "High Quality" and File Integrity
The term "high quality," often associated with software downloads, usually refers to the fidelity of the installation files—ensuring they are complete, uncorrupted, and fully functional. For a software package as complex as MATLAB, which encompasses gigabytes of data, toolboxes, and compilers, the integrity of the source file is paramount.
Obtaining a "high quality" version is not merely about having a working program; it is about ensuring computational accuracy. Corrupted or tampered installation files can lead to subtle errors in mathematical computations, library linking, or compilation outputs. In professional engineering environments, a faulty calculation due to compromised software can have catastrophic real-world consequences. Therefore, verifying the digital signature of the installer and ensuring the package is the authentic release from MathWorks is a necessity for serious work.
